As part of this effort, AT&T recently made several network enhancements in Southeast Alaska – giving residents, businesses and visitors a big boost in their wireless connectivity. AT&T upgraded network infrastructure for 11 sites around Juneau and Skagway, more than doubling the areas network capacity.
Enhancements went live this summer and came after several years of efforts to boost service in the area.
